The 1987 West Coast Athletic Conference Men's Basketball Tournament (now known as the West Coast Conference Men's Basketball Tournament) was held February 28–March 2 at the War Memorial Gymnasium at the University of San Francisco in San Francisco, California. This was the first edition of the tournament.

Fifth-seeded Santa Clara defeated seventh-seeded Pepperdine in the championship game, 77–65, to win their first WCAC/WCC tournament championship.

The Broncos, in turn, received an automatic bid to the 1987 NCAA Tournament. Top-seeded San Diego, who lost in the conference semifinals, also received an at-large bid.
